コード例 #1
0
        private void DocCevap_PrintPage(object sender, PrintPageEventArgs e)
        {
            Bitmap bc = new Bitmap(PictureCevap.Width, PictureCevap.Height);

            PictureCevap.DrawToBitmap(bc, new Rectangle(0, 0, PictureCevap.Width, PictureCevap.Height));
            e.Graphics.DrawImage(bc, 10, 10);
            bc.Dispose();
        }
コード例 #2
0
        //yazdırma işleme
        private void BtnYazıdr_Click(object sender, EventArgs e)
        {
            PrintDialog   pd  = new PrintDialog();
            PrintDocument doc = new PrintDocument();

            doc.PrintPage   += Doc_PrintPage;
            doc.DocumentName = "Sorular";
            pd.Document      = doc;
            if (pd.ShowDialog() == DialogResult.OK)
            {
                doc.Print();
                CevapYaz.BringToFront();
                PictureCevap.BringToFront();
                uyarıClass.Alert("Sorularınız başarlıyla kayıt edildi", BildirimForms.EnmType.Success);
                dataBaseIslem.SorulariGuncelle(20);
            }
        }